## Formula sandbox tuning

User-supplied formulas in Gridmoor execute inside a restricted interpreter with hard ceilings on time, memory, and call depth. Reviewers should confirm any change to these ceilings is justified in the PR description, since raising them widens the abuse surface. Defaults were chosen from production traces. The current limits are as follows.

limits module of tafog-fawip:
WEIGHTS = {
    "julix": 57,
    "lamys": 992,
    "kasvan": 209,
    "quenok": 750,
    "alddor": 259,
    "oliath": 1009,
    "wenix": 815,
}

When Driftwell ingests uploaded text files, the detector samples the first 64 KB and scores candidate encodings before committing to a conversion. If confidence falls below 0.85, the file is quarantined for manual review — never guess. The detection worker authenticates to the quarantine store at startup, so your .env must include the following line:

secret setting of yajog-taguf: ARCHIVE_KEY3=051

v2.7.1 — Rotated the signing key for the Fernvale clinic reminder job after the quarterly audit flagged the old pair as overdue. Reminder dispatch logic is unchanged; only the verification step in the cron wrapper now expects the new key. Old key is revoked effective this release. The replacement public key follows.

release key, fahaf-bajof: bky3_Xam